- 下载windows webp 格式化软件 https://developers.google.com/speed/webp/download
- 解压到软件目录,配置环境变量,在path中加入D:\Software\libwebp-0.4.3-windows-x86\bin
- jpg/png to webp 在命令行下输入 ```bash F:\exemple\webp>cwebp -q 80 test.jpg -o test.webp Saving file 'test.webp' File: test.jpg Dimension: 1746 x 1235 Output: 135428 bytes Y-U-V-All-PSNR 43.52 45.71 47.10 44.27 dB block count: intra4: 4222
intra16: 4358 (-> 50.79%) skipped block: 1240 (14.45%)
bytes used: header: 370 (0.3%)
mode-partition: 16155 (11.9%)
Residuals bytes |segment 1|segment 2|segment 3|segment 4| total macroblocks: | 1%| 6%| 19%| 72%| 8580 quantizer: | 27 | 27 | 22 | 18 | filter level: | 8 | 5 | 5 | 8 |
F:\exemple\webp>
我将处理后的图片上传的图片服务器上,因为要在网络上访问。
写一个html文件
```html
<html>
<head>
<meta charset="utf-8" />
<script type="text/javascript" src="./webpjs-0.0.2.min.js"></script>
</head>
<body>
<div>
<img src="http://7xj0ix.com1.z0.glb.clouddn.com/test.jpg"/>
</div>
<hr/><hr/><hr/>
<hr/><hr/><hr/>
<div>
<img src="http://7xj0ix.com1.z0.glb.clouddn.com/test.webp"/>
</div>
</body>
</html>
因为webp并非所有浏览器都支持,故用了webpjs插件做兼容。 在火狐下查看流量。
当然我认为webp的使用场景还是移动端,web端看到的图片实际是flash解码,如图片都比较小的情况是不必如此浪费的。
时间: 2024-08-28 05:04:59